1. What Exactly Is a Tanuki?
The tanuki is a species of raccoon dog native to East Asia, particularly Japan. Theyโre often depicted in folklore and popular culture as clever, mischievous beings with a penchant for disguise. In reality, theyโre quite different from their cartoon counterparts. Tanukis are nocturnal, omnivorous, and can grow up to 28 inches long, including their tails. ๐ฆ๐
2. The Cost of Owning a Tanuki
So, what does it cost to bring a tanuki home? The price can vary widely depending on factors such as location, breeder, and the tanukiโs age. Generally, you might pay anywhere from $1,000 to $5,000 for a pet tanuki. However, this is just the starting point. Additional costs include veterinary care, specialized diets, and possibly legal fees if your state or country has restrictions on exotic pets. ๐ฐ๐ฅ
3. Are Tanukis Good Pets?
Before you decide to adopt a tanuki, consider the challenges. These animals require a lot of attention and space to thrive. They are wild at heart and may not adapt well to domestic life. Moreover, owning an exotic pet comes with ethical considerations and potential legal hurdles. In many places, keeping a tanuki as a pet is illegal due to concerns over animal welfare and environmental impact. ๐ซโ๏ธ
